Programėlė
kontrolinis sąrašas

    kontaktas





    Mūsų dienoraštis

    Mes užprogramuojame jūsų matomumą! Teigiamas veikimas naudojant ONMA scout Android programėlę garantuojamas.

    kontaktas
    Android programėlių kūrimas

    Mūsų dienoraštis


    Patarimai, kaip rasti „Android“ programuotojo darbą

    android programuotojas

    „Android“ programuotojas yra programinės įrangos kūrėjas, turintis mobiliųjų programų kūrimo patirties. Šis vaidmuo reikalauja puikių programavimo įgūdžių, matematika, ir patirties įgyvendinant esamas koncepcijas. Geras Android programuotojas bus susipažinęs su Java, Android SDK, ir Android programavimo kalba. Toliau pateiktame darbo aprašyme yra keletas patarimų, kaip įsidarbinti „Android“ programuotoju.

    Android programuotojo darbo aprašymas

    „Android“ programuotojas yra programinės įrangos kūrėjas, kuriantis įvairiuose įrenginiuose veikiančias programas. Jų darbas apima vartotojų poreikių supratimą ir vadovavimą visam programinės įrangos kūrimo procesui. Norėdami gauti "Android" programuotojo kvalifikaciją, turite turėti bent bakalauro laipsnį susijusioje srityje ir tam tikrą programavimo patirtį.

    „Android“ programuotojas turi gerai išmanyti „Android“ ekosistemą ir būti susipažinęs su geriausia programinės įrangos kūrimo praktika. Jie taip pat turi turėti didelę mobiliojo ryšio kūrimo patirtį, įskaitant populiarias programų sistemas. Jie turi sugebėti išlaikyti esamas kodų bazes ir kurti naujas. Jie taip pat turi laikytis geriausios pramonės praktikos ir kodavimo gairių. Papildomai, kai kurie „Android“ kūrėjai specializuojasi vaizdo žaidimų ar aparatinės įrangos kūrimo srityje.

    Kitas įgūdis, kurį turi turėti „Android“ kūrėjai, yra galimybė patikrinti kodą ir užtikrinti, kad klaidos būtų ištaisytos efektyviai.. Papildomai, jie turi suprasti, kaip naudoti SQLite, duomenų bazė, naudojama duomenims visam laikui išsaugoti. Pagaliau, jie turi turėti galimybę vienetiniu būdu patikrinti savo kodo tvirtumą, kraštiniai dėklai, tinkamumas naudoti, ir bendras patikimumas.

    „Android“ kūrėjai yra atsakingi už programų kodo rašymą ir jų priežiūrą. Jie naudoja JavaScript, C/C++, ir keletas kitų programinės įrangos kūrimo ir priežiūros įrankių. Jie turi būti kruopštūs savo kodo detalėms, nes dėl vienos neteisingai įvestos kodo eilutės programa gali tapti netinkama naudoti. Jie taip pat glaudžiai bendradarbiauja su produktų vystymu, Vartotojo patirtis, ir kiti skyriai, skirti kurti ir kurti naujas funkcijas. Jie taip pat turėtų būti pasirengę dirbti kaip komandos nariai ir suprasti savo bendradarbių reikalavimus.

    Turi turėti gerus programavimo įgūdžius

    „Android“ programuotojas turėtų gerai išmanyti „Java“ ir „Kotlin“ programavimo kalbas. Jie taip pat turėtų būti susipažinę su kelių platformų įrankiais, kurie leis kurti programas, kurios bus suderinamos tiek su iOS, tiek su Android įrenginiais.. Taip pat naudinga pasiskaityti apie operacines sistemas ir SDK išteklius, kurie gali padėti jiems lengviau įsisavinti skirtingas kalbos dalis.

    Įgudęs „Android“ programuotojas taip pat gali parašyti „Java“ kodą, kad pritaikytų savo programos išdėstymą vykdymo metu. Žiniatinklio kūrėjai paprastai naudoja „JavaScript“, kad vykdymo metu pakeistų svetainės išvaizdą ir funkcijas. Jie taip pat turi suprasti XML ir SDK, kurios yra iš anksto supakuotos kodo dalys, leidžiančios kūrėjams pasiekti konkrečias mobiliųjų įrenginių funkcijas.

    Android yra didžiulė platforma, ir per mėnesį to išmokti iki galo neįmanoma. Kaip moki, suprasite, kiek daug nežinote. Tačiau nenusiminkite. Sužinokite kuo daugiau apie programų kūrimą ir išplėskite savo žinias. Nebijokite kopijuoti kitų kūrėjų kodo – dauguma jų nesivargins skaityti savo kodo.

    Android kūrėjai turi turėti gerus bendravimo ir komandinio darbo įgūdžius. Tai svarbi bet kokio darbo dalis ir padės jiems gerai dirbti komandoje. Jie turi gebėti efektyviai bendrauti su netechniniais specialistais ir gebėti paaiškinti sudėtingus procesus neprofesionaliai.. Ir jie turi mokėti rašyti įvairioms auditorijoms.

    Kitas svarbus aspektas – geras įvairių bibliotekų ir API, kurias naudoja „Android“ programos, supratimas. „Android“ kūrėjai turi būti susipažinę su šiomis bibliotekomis, kad galėtų rašyti programas, kurios integruojamos su duomenų baze. Jie taip pat turi žinoti, kaip testuoti savo programas viso kūrimo proceso metu. Ir svarbu žinoti, kaip išbandyti programas, kad įsitikintumėte, jog jose nėra klaidų.

    Yra du skirtingi „Android“ kūrėjų tipai: programų programuotojai ir pagrindiniai programuotojai. Pagrindiniai programuotojai daugiausia dėmesio skiria išmaniesiems įrenginiams skirtos programinės įrangos kūrimui ir dirba tokią įrangą gaminančioms įmonėms. Programėlių kūrėjai, iš kitos pusės, sutelkite dėmesį į programų, kurias vartotojai gali atsisiųsti iš „Google Play“ parduotuvės ir kitų palaikomų parduotuvių, rašymą. „Android“ yra galinga operacinė sistema, todėl į „Google Play“ parduotuvę kasdien pridedama daug programų. Programų kūrėjai gali gauti didelį pelną, jei jų programos yra populiarios.

    Turi turėti gerus matematinius įgūdžius

    Jei svarstote apie „Android“ kūrimo karjerą, būtina turėti gerus matematinius įgūdžius. Svarbu ne tik suprasti pagrindines sąvokas, bet jūs taip pat turite mokėti logiškai mąstyti. Nesvarbu, ar ketinate kurti žaidimą, ar ekrano užsklandą, matematika vaidina svarbų vaidmenį. Turėsite galvoti apie savo veiksmų pasekmes ir numatyti rezultatą.

    Nors jums nereikia turėti pažangių matematikos įgūdžių, kad galėtumėte koduoti, svarbu turėti tam tikro dalyko žinių. Dažniausiai kodo kūrimui naudojama matematika yra Būlio algebra. Šio tipo matematika yra lengvai suprantama ir gali būti naudojama programose be didelių sunkumų. Tačiau, galbūt norėsite lankyti tolesnius matematikos kursus, kad geriau suprastumėte pažangias sąvokas.

    Turėti patirties įgyvendinant esamas koncepcijas

    Jei norite tapti Android programuotoju, turėtumėte nuolat tobulinti savo įgūdžius mokydamiesi naujų programavimo kalbų. JavaScript yra puiki vieta pradėti. Kitas dalykas, kurį turėtumėte žinoti, yra dizaino modeliai. Tai naudingi gudrybės „Android“ programuotojams ir gali sutaupyti daug laiko.

    Kaip Android programuotojas, taip pat turėtumėte žinoti apie įvairias sistemas. „Android“ kūrėjams dažnai reikia trečiųjų šalių bibliotekų. Jie turėtų galėti pagerinti savo programų našumą. Jie taip pat turėtų mokėti naudotis naujomis technologijomis. Svarbu būti lanksčiam ir prisitaikančiam.

    mūsų vaizdo įrašas
    Gaukite nemokamą citatą